Jscrambler is a client-side security company that offers a platform for protecting JavaScript code and managing third-party scripts. Their solutions aim to prevent data breaches, skimming attacks, and other client-side threats while helping businesses achieve compliance with regulations like PCI DSS.

Jscrambler operates in the cybersecurity industry, specializing in client-side security solutions.
Jscrambler's primary user base is in the United States and the United Kingdom, indicating a strong presence in major English-speaking markets with robust e-commerce and technology sectors.

Jscrambler primarily targets e-commerce businesses, financial institutions, and companies in industries handling sensitive data like healthcare and gaming. They offer solutions for a range of needs, from protecting first-party code to managing third-party scripts and ensuring PCI DSS compliance.
